About This Item

New Haven: Yale University Press, 1943 Book. Very Good. Hardcover. First Edition.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. first edition/second printing book is tight with no markings, some tanning and light soiling to page edges, board edges and corners have some bumping and rubbing, dj has rubbing and soiling, edges have curling/creasing, numerous small tears and chipping along the edges,.
